About Emmanuel Moss
Emmanuel Moss is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Epidemiology and Physiology, having authored 34 papers that have together received 542 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cardiac and Coronary Surgery Techniques (12 papers),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(9 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(6 papers), Infective Endocarditis Diagnosis and Management (5 papers),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(5 papers),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(5 papers), Aortic Disease and Treatment Approaches (4 papers) and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(337 citations), Geriatrics and Gerontology (38 citations), Surgery (332 citations),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(21 citations) and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(105 citations). Emmanuel Moss has collaborated with scholars based in Canada, United States and Denmark. Frequent co-authors include Michael E. Halkos, Douglas A. Murphy, Vinod H. Thourani, Robert A. Guyton, José Binongo, Jeffrey S. Miller, Lawrence Rudski, Melissa Bendayan, Jonathan Afilalo and John D. Puskas. Their work appears in journals such as The Annals of Thoracic Surgery, Canadian Journal of Cardiology, Journal of the American Heart Association, Autonomic Neuroscience and Annals of Cardiothoracic Surgery.
